Neuropace re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of -$0.20, beating the consensus estimate of -$0.2346 by 14.75%. Revenue data was not disclosed in the provided information. The stock rose 3.93% following the announcement, indicating a positive market reaction to the narrower-than-expected loss.

The company reported a net loss per share of -$0.20, an improvement from the -$0.2346 analysts had anticipated. This beat reflects potential progress in controlling expenses, even as top-line figures were not specified. The company focuses on its Responsive Neurostimulation (RNS) System for drug-resistant epilepsy, a market with growing adoption. The stock’s 3.93% rise reflects a favorable initial reaction to the EPS surprise, as investors often reward companies that outperform on profitability metrics. Analyst views may become more positive if the trend of narrower losses continues, potentially leading to upward estimate revisions. However, without revenue details, some analysts might adopt a wait-and-see approach, focusing on future quarters for top-line confirmation. The narrower loss could be interpreted as a sign that Neuropace is on a path toward breakeven, though the timeline remains uncertain. Key catalysts to watch include next quarter’s revenue figures, RNS System procedure volumes, and any news on regulatory approvals or clinical trial results.
